The Fundamental Authentication Check: The "Gucci" Mark
One of the most crucial steps in verifying the authenticity of any Gucci sunglasses, including those with crystal embellishments, is examining the frame's interior. Specifically, look at the bottom of the frame's temple (the arm that rests on your ear). The name "Gucci" should be clearly and precisely printed in the center. The font will be consistent with the brand's current branding guidelines. The lettering will be crisp, clean, and evenly spaced. A blurry, uneven, or misspelled "Gucci" is a significant red flag indicating a counterfeit product. The absence of this marking is a definitive sign of a fake. No amount of convincing crystal embellishments can compensate for the lack of this fundamental authentication mark.

Examining the Crystal Embellishments: Quality and Placement
Beyond the "Gucci" marking, the quality and placement of the crystals themselves are critical indicators of authenticity. On genuine Gucci sunglasses, the crystals will be securely affixed, exhibiting consistent size, shape, and brilliance. The settings will be meticulously crafted, with no loose or wobbly crystals. Counterfeit sunglasses often display unevenly spaced crystals, differing crystal sizes, or crystals that appear loosely attached, potentially falling off with minimal handling. Pay close attention to the overall craftsmanship; authentic Gucci sunglasses will exhibit a level of precision and detail that is often lacking in counterfeit versions.
Gucci Crystal Embellished Sunglasses: Packaging and Documentation
The packaging and accompanying documentation play a vital role in authenticating Gucci sunglasses. Genuine Gucci sunglasses arrive in a branded case, usually a hard case with the Gucci logo prominently displayed. The case should be of high quality, showcasing the brand's attention to detail. Inside the case, you should find a cleaning cloth bearing the Gucci logo and, ideally, a certificate of authenticity or other documentation confirming the purchase and the authenticity of the sunglasses. The authenticity card will often feature a unique serial number that can be verified on Gucci's official website. If the packaging is flimsy, lacks branding, or is missing crucial documents, it's a strong indication that the sunglasses are counterfeit.
